    Wrightsville beach bottom bouncin 2/11

    Bottom fished yesterday out of wrightsville beach. Seas were a little sloppy in the morning but not too bad so we headed off to our first spot. It was kinda slow at our first couple spots but eventually got on a good ledge and put some groupers in the boat. We had 10 keeper reds 2 about 24 inches, 1 scamp, and a slob of a gag that weighed in at 22.1 pounds. My first citation grouper. The gag came on a seven seas hooker jig that he hit as soon as it hit the bottom. Arlen lived up to his title as president of ASS (Amberjack Sportsmans Society) landing one about 40 lbs on the jig. All in all it was an awesome day on the water with slick seas for the ride home. Could not have asked for a better trip.

    I know it happens elsewhere but im ready for it to happen to me off of the North Carolina coast. It was my new jigging rod. The rod is a smith AMJ and the reel is a shimano twinpower 8000. The reel is an equivalent to the US Sustain but it feel much smoother to me and it puts out 35-40 pounds of drag. It is awesome reel. The rod is designed specifically for jigging and is only 5'4" and almost half of it is the butt section. It is a different looking rod but it is incredible how much power that rod has. Similar to a trevala but much better and more powerful. Arlen has a picture of me fighting the fish. I ll get him to post the picture and you can really see the rod in action.
